InfluencesTOMMY TALLARICO
Executive Producer



Tommy is President of Tommy Tallarico Studios, Inc., the most successful company dedicated to the art of music composition, sound design and voice over production in the video game industry with over 200 games produced and winner of over 20 industry awards since 1991. He also plays host and producer of 2 television shows Judgment Day and Electric Playground, which play daily or weekly in over 100 million homes worldwide on the G4 network, MTV International and others. Tommy serves as President and Founder of the Game Audio Network Guild, an organization formed to promote excellence in game audio with over 700 members since it’s inception in 2002. JACK WALL
Executive Producer



Jack Wall is one of the industry’s top award winning composers of music in video games since 1996. With over 30 game scores to his credit, he has built a track record and an international reputation as an A-List composer and music producer in the interactive entertainment sector. Previous to 1996, Jack was engineer and producer for such artists as John Cale, David Byrne and Patti Smith among others. Jack is Senior Director and Co-Founder of the Game Audio Network Guild. WHAT IS VIDEO GAMES LIVE!?!?!?!

Video Games Live is an immersive concert event featuring music from the biggest video games of all time. Top orchestras and choirs across the world perform along with exclusive video footage and music arrangements, lasers, synchronized lighting, solo performers, electronic percussionists, live action and unique interactive segments to create an explosive one-of-a-kind entertainment experience.

Video Games Live is a complete celebration of the fastest growing entertainment market. The festival atmosphere of Video Games Live includes pre and post show events such as costume contests, playable demos, prizes, game designer/composer meet and greets and more.


  • Video Games Live combines the energy and special effects of a rock concert, the emotions and power of a live symphony orchestra, and the exciting cutting edge interactive technology of video games all into a live concert event.


  • The debut performance on July 6th, 2005 at the Hollywood Bowl with the LA Philharmonic Orchestra saw over 10,000 audience members take part in the biggest video game concert in history.


  • The concert tour will be renewed with a refurbishment of the show on an annual basis. We will grow each market, one concert at a time, partnering with local symphonies and co-marketing the event with established video game, anime, sci-fi, and comic book related conventions and festivals.


Announced Game Titles in Video Games Live for the 2008 concert tour:

Currently featuring music and exclusive video from popular franchises such as: Mario--, Zelda®, Halo®, Metal Gear Solid®, Warcraft®, Myst®, Final Fantasy®, Castlevania®, Kingdom Hearts, Medal of Honor--, Sonic--, Tron, God of War--, Civilization IV, Tomb Raider®, Beyond Good & Evil--, Advent Rising, EverQuest® II, Monkey Island, Earthworm Jim, Pac-Man, Headhunter, Splinter Cell®, Ghost Recon--, Rainbow Six®, Jade Empire, BioShock, Mass Effect, Contra and a special retro Classic Arcade Medley featuring over 20+ games from Pong® to Donkey Kong® including such classics as Dragon's Lair, Tetris, Frogger, Gauntlet, Space Invaders & Outrun!
